The equation of the circle which cuts the circles ( aligned & S₁ x^2+y^2-4=0 & S₂ x^2+y^2-6 x-8 y+10=0 & S₃ x^2+y^2+2 x-4 y-2=0 aligned ) at the extremities of diameters of these circles is

Options

  1. A(x^2+y^2-4 x-6 y-4=0 )
  2. B(x^2+y^2+4 x-4=0 )
  3. C(x^2+y^2=25 )
  4. D(x^2+y^2+x+y+1=0 )

Correct answer

A. (x^2+y^2-4 x-6 y-4=0 )

Step-by-step solution

Let the equation of required circle is (S x^2+y^2+2 g x+2 f y+c=0 ) and equation of given circles ( aligned & S₁ x^2+y^2-4=0 & S₂ x^2+y^2-6 x-8 y+10=0 & S₃=x^2+y^2+2 x-4 y-2=0 aligned ) ( ) Circle (S=0 ) cuts the circles (S₁=0, S₂=0 ) and (S₃=0 ) at the extermities of the diameters, so common chord of (S=0 ) and (S₁=0 ) passes through the centre of the circle (S₁=0 ), so (c=-4 ) Similarly ((2 g+6) x+(2 f+8) y-14=0 ) passes through ((3,4) ), so (6 g+8 f+36=0 ) ( 3 g+4 f+18=0 )...(i) and ((2 g-2) x+(2 f+4) y-2=0 ), p
